The series of Youth Leadership Development Workshops are organized by Center for Sustainable Development Studies (CSDS) in collaboration with Oxfam and 2030 Youth Force in Vietnam in three cities throughout Vietnam for youth leaders – representatives of members of 2030 Youth Force in Vietnam and ones of projects granted by the small grant program “Youth Initiatives for SDGs”. These workshops belong to a set of activities with the aim of developing youth capacity to contribute to communities and strengthen their voices, their roles in communities and policy making via impact in active youth groups and their leaders.

OUR GOALS 
  • Form an enabling space whereby youth leaders actively create the big picture of sustainable development and determine the current role, position, desire and capabilities of youth in that picture;
  • Initiate a series of impact, starting with youth leaders, and national youth force being the next in line and eventually effecting on communities, youth will be the key agents contributing to sustainable development;
  • Bring about the opportunities for youth to determine core problems in areas of development that they are working on, based on that, a direction for elevating/delving into their activities is found and following discoveries, actions are taken;
  • Enhance the connection between youth groups inside and outside the 2030YFV network, helping building a strong community of youth groups. This connection will be made real with a shared activity after the workshop.
CONTEXT Among many youth groups who are actively contributing to the development of the community in various fields, only a few of them aims at helping the community to tackle their own issues. The rest of these groups are delivering service themselves, with the communities being the beneficiary. In order to enhance efficiency and strengthen their voice in community and development, orientation and development tools are necessary for them. The series of Youth Leadership Development Workshops hope to help solve this problem.

ORGANIZERS Center for Sustainable Development Studies (CSDS) is a Vietnamese non-governmental organization, focusing on youth and community development as well as international volunteer exchange. Founded in 2009, CSDS develops and implements programs in different areas of the country to contribute to the sustainable development of Vietnamese society.

2030 Youth Force is a network of young leaders from Asia-Pacific countries, founded by UNDP/UNV in Asia. 2030 Youth Force works for the following goals:

  • Inspire youth to participate in activities which contribute to complete the 17 SDGs.
  • Motivate youth to create optimistic changes towards an inclusive and peaceful society.

In Viet Nam, 2030 Youth Force is the network in which youth organizations with mutual targets and visions, aims at promoting youth to create positive changes for society, in association with the objective of promoting the completion of 17 Sustainable Development Goals (17 SDGs) of United Nations in 2030.
